Set Adobe Premiere Pro as the default MCDB program

Changing Default Programs in Windows

  1. Right-click on your MCDB file, then choose the "Open with" option and select "Choose another application" from the available options;
  2. In the pop-up window, select the Adobe Premiere Pro application;
  3. Check the "Always use this application" checkbox, and then click "OK" to apply the selected application as the default for opening MCDB files.

Change Default Program on Mac

  1. Right click or Control + left click on the desired MCDB file;
  2. Select "Open in application" and click "Other";
  3. At the bottom of the window, you will find the "Enable" menu. Default, will be set to "Recommended Programs";
  4. Choose "All Programs" in this menu and search for Adobe Premiere Pro. Check the box next to "Always open in app" to make it the default program.
